目的通过对支配眼轮匝肌的神经上的神经电信号(ENG)的分析,监控眼轮匝肌的功能状态。方法通过植入狗面神经颧支周围的cuff电极,在体记录神经电信号。分析眼轮匝肌处于舒张状态与收缩状态时ENG的差异性,以找出监控眼轮匝肌功能状态的方法。结果研究中我们提取到了能反映眨眼动作发生的ENG,经时、频域分析显示,眼轮匝肌处于舒张状态时,无论这种舒张状态是处于自然睁眼期间,还是处于眨眼动作的间期,其支配神经上的神经信号是一致的;而当眼轮匝肌处于收缩状态时,其神经信号幅值和频率都明显不同于舒张状态。结论可以通过对ENG的分析来监测眼轮匝肌的功能状态。
Objective To monitor the functional status of orbicularis oculi muscle by analyzing the nerve electrical signals (ENG) that dominate the orbicularis oculi muscle. Methods Implantation of cuff electrodes around the zygomatic branch of dog facial nerve recorded electrical signals in the body. Analyze the difference of ENG in the orbicularis muscle between the diastolic and the contractile state to find out the method to monitor the functional state of orbicularis muscle. Results In the study, we extracted the ENG which can reflect the blinking action. Time-frequency and frequency-domain analysis showed that when the orbicularis oculi muscle is in the state of relaxation, whether this diastole is in the natural open-eye or in the blink-eye , Which dominate the nerve signals on the nerve is consistent; and when the orbicularis muscle in contraction state, the nerve signal amplitude and frequency are significantly different from the diastolic state. Conclusion The functional status of orbicularis oculi muscle can be monitored by analyzing ENG.
